加入收藏 | 设为首页 | 会员中心 | 我要投稿 李大同 (https://www.lidatong.com.cn/)- 科技、建站、经验、云计算、5G、大数据,站长网!
当前位置: 首页 > 创业 > C语言 > 正文

前后端分离之 API管理

发布时间:2020-12-15 00:42:38 所属栏目:C语言 来源:网络整理
导读:现在的web应用,前后端分离越来越多的被采用,可以一套后端对应PC,app等。但是在开发和维护中,对于接口的管理确存在不小的挑战。如果管理不好,会导致系统很长时间不能稳定,甚至会影响项目的生存。 最近在做一个WEB的协同项目,因为接口的关系,专门搜索

现在的web应用,前后端分离越来越多的被采用,可以一套后端对应PC,app等。但是在开发和维护中,对于接口的管理确存在不小的挑战。如果管理不好,会导致系统很长时间不能稳定,甚至会影响项目的生存。

最近在做一个WEB的协同项目,因为接口的关系,专门搜索了一些接口管理的工具和平台。

1、Swagger ui

swagger ui是一个API在线文档生成和测试的利器,目前发现最好用的。
为什么好用?Demo 传送门
支持API自动生成同步的在线文档
这些文档可用于项目内部API审核
方便测试人员了解API
这些文档可作为客户产品文档的一部分进行发布
支持API规范生成代码,生成的客户端和服务器端骨架代码可以加速开发和测试速度

文/Damonwong(简书作者)
原文链接:http://www.jianshu.com/p/d6626e6bd72c
著作权归作者所有,转载请联系作者获得授权,并标注“简书作者”。

2、一款Windows上的API Documentation工具 - Velocity。

3、Mac上的Dash是一款非常出色的API文档管理工具,是程序开发的绝佳辅助工具

4、国际领先的开源SOA解决方案提供者WSO2近日发布了一个开源的API管理平台(WSO2 API Manager),该平台为开发者发布API、创建和管理开发者社区、扩展路由流量、确保API内容提供
了一个完整的解决方案。该API管理器在Apache 2.0许可协议下开源。

(编辑:李大同)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章
      热点阅读